This file controls the telemetry gateway that
# ingests sensor data from tractors and irrigation rigs in the
# field fleet. Please read each setting before changing it.
# GATEWAY_PORT must stay at 8443 unless networking approves a
# change. TELEMETRY_BUFFER_MB controls on-disk spooling during
# outages; 256 is the tested default. The broker connection
# requires an authentication secret, which is set on the line
# immediately below this comment block.

vault entry, yajop-bafop: ARCHIVE_KEY3=8d4

Ticket: DEDUP-442 — Expired credentials on alert deduplicator

The Quellbird deduplication service stopped suppressing duplicate pages overnight. Root cause: its credential for the internal incident-store API expired on schedule, but the rotation job in the Marrow cluster silently failed. On-call volume tripled until 06:40.

Rotation job has been fixed and re-run. For audit purposes, the replacement credential issued to the deduplicator is recorded below.

gateway credential: kto23_LX9A4ys6i4nzHtpOLNLodKK

Alert: FIRMWARE_CHANNEL_STALE fires when a Dunmore device fleet has not acknowledged an update manifest from its assigned channel within 72 hours. Common causes include a paused rollout ring, a signing-key rotation that invalidated the manifest, or devices pinned to a retired channel. Before escalating, verify the channel's last publish timestamp and the signature validation logs. Triage steps and the channel ownership matrix live on the page below.

dashboard of yafog-fajof = https://jira.tolvaqsys.internal/pages/pages/projects/49fe21c4